How they compare
Fiji currently reports 46.78 % against 45.7 % in Slovenia, a difference of 1.08 %.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 32 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Fiji ahead.
Fiji ranks 102nd and Slovenia ranks 105th of 209 countries.
Fiji has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ions indicators disseminates indicators on sectoral shares of total national gre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ions as well as three indicators of emissions intensity: per capita emissions; emissions per value of agricultural production; and emissions per area of agricultural land.
